Development of Immunocompetence

The initiation of cell-mediated immunity can be observed as early as the third month of fetal growth, with active antibody-mediated immunity following approximately one month later.
The initial cells that migrate from the fetal thymus settle within the skin and epithelial tissues lining the mouth, digestive tract, and in females, the uterus and vagina. These cells, including skin-based dendritic cells, serve as antigen-presenting cells, playing a key role in T cell activation.

Smallpox

Smallpox is a severe contagious disease caused by the Variola major virus, a double-stranded DNA member of the Poxviridae family.Variola major transmission occurs primarily via inhalation of virus-laden droplets or direct contact with infectious scabs. The incubation period averages approximately seven days, although it may range from 7 to 17 days depending on the inoculum and host factors.Clinically, the prodromal phase is marked by an abrupt onset of high fever, malaise, headache, and myalgia.

Accessory Structures of the Skin: Sebaceous Glands

A sebaceous gland is a type of oil gland found almost all over the skin ( except palms and soles) and helps lubricate and waterproof the skin and hair. Most sebaceous glands are associated with hair follicles. They generate and excrete sebum, a mixture of lipids, onto the skin surface, thereby naturally lubricating the dry and dead layer of keratinized cells of the stratum corneum, keeping it pliable.

An infant with bullous pemphigoid.

António Luís Santos1, Alberto Vieira Mota, José Ramon

  • 1Dermatology Department, Hospital de São João and Faculty of Medicine of Oporto, Portugal.

Dermatology Online Journal
|March 11, 2008
PubMed
Summary

Bullous pemphigoid, a rare autoimmune blistering disease in infants, presented unusually on palms and soles in a 5-month-old. Early diagnosis and treatment with oral deflazacort led to a favorable outcome.

Area of Science:

  • Dermatology
  • Pediatric Autoimmunology
  • Immunobullous Diseases

Background:

  • Bullous pemphigoid (BP) is a rare autoimmune blistering disease in children.
  • It typically affects the elderly, with pediatric cases being exceptionally uncommon.

Observation:

  • A 5-month-old male infant presented with bullae localized to palms and soles.
  • Peripheral blood showed relative eosinophilia.
  • Skin biopsy revealed subepidermal blisters, eosinophilic dermal infiltrate, and collagen flame figures.

Findings:

  • Direct immunofluorescence confirmed linear C3c and IgG deposition at the dermal-epidermal junction.
  • Absence of IgA was noted.
  • Histopathological findings were consistent with bullous pemphigoid.

Implications:

  • This case highlights an unusual acral presentation of bullous pemphigoid in an infant.
  • Prompt diagnosis and treatment with corticosteroids can lead to favorable outcomes in pediatric bullous pemphigoid.
  • Further research into the specific triggers and management of infantile bullous pemphigoid is warranted.
